Abstract

This article proposes a software fusion processing method for multi-sensor monitoring the Internet of Things based on the fractional differential filtering algorithm. The purpose is to solve the difference between the detection data caused by the difference in each production information sampling node's equipment performance and working environment. The article applies the above algorithm to the remote detection data fusion processing experiment of the discrete manufacturing system of the Internet of Things. The research found that the algorithm realizes the remote high-precision measurement of the Internet of Things sensor information. The fractional integral operator has high fusion accuracy in remote detection data fusion processing.
